- 64k BeOS Linux MS-Dos Windows Stash by The Black Lotus [web]
- I didn't vote on this baby so far? Gosh!
Anyway, the greatest thing was when they showed the intro at TP7, the screen went black, everyone was applauding and cheering...
... sone lonely voice from the back of the hall shouted "part two!" ...
... everyone was laughing ...
... and then part two started. And the laughter was stuck in everyone's throats. It was just TOO unbelievable.
Stash definitely was a milestone, manifested the concepts of softsynths and the dutch color scheme(TM) in everyone's mind, and finally put an end to all those "hey, i can do marching cubes, too" intros. Definitely a thumbs up.
